Chapter Seventeen

Freedom, Kansas

Three nights later, Cenobia was humming along to the music playing on the kitchen sound system and handing the rinsed-off dishes to Adán who was stacking them in the dishwasher when she realized she hadn’t thought of her car or her company once since she’d woken up.

Pleasantly stuffed on steaks and elote that Bartolo had prepared, and waiting for the men to return with firewood before beginning a comedy movie marathon—Nosotros Los Nobles then No Se Aceptan Devoluciones—she also realized that she didn’t care that she hadn’t thought about car or company.

Her father was out of the hospital and recovering with full-time care at home, his already beefed-up security augmented by Sheppard Security and a ring of Guardia Nacional surrounding the compound. With eleven days until the launch of La Primera at the Frankfurt Auto Show, her staff was seeing to the last details, all of the cobots were repaired and being installed on the line, and five perfect examples of La Primera were approaching the port at Duisburg-Ruhrort.

Sheppard Security had traced the cobot sabotage to a small cell of eco-tech terrorists out of Jalisco, but the five teens and twentysomethings had already fled the country by the time the team arrived. They were now hunting them internationally, anticipating proof that Las Luces Oscuras had paid their bill.

The one cloud in Glori’s latest report: she still hadn’t uncovered the leak. In fact, all of her efforts to uncover the leak—planting bugs, whispering false rumors, even hiring a subcontractor to offer bribes and favors to members of both teams—had been so fruitless, Glori wrote, that she would have declared there was no leak. Except for the obvious evidence to the contrary.

But Cenobia’s loved ones were safe, Trujillo Industries was churning along, and she was staying as engaged as circumstances would allow. She’d given the full decade of her twenties to the company. Now, in this strange forced vacation, it was difficult for her to care what was going on beyond the grey lake and tall trees.

She let her eyes linger on Adán as he figured out how to get a baking sheet in the dishwasher. She’d hated the sense that her father wanted her to be nothing but pretty and useless. While she’d never prioritized learning to cook, she now knew how to properly chop vegetables and get a good sear on a steak. Here Adán, too, had learned things that would see him through whatever life threw his way: how to fill a dishwasher, how to make an apple pie, how to fold laundry. How to drive.

She’d continued Adán’s driving lessons, despite Bartolo’s grumbles. She was glad for this time with the bodyguard who’d always stood by her side like it was a choice he’d made, instead of a job. He’d entirely abandoned his own personal life to protect her, then essentially raised Adán. She hoped, in time, that he could forgive himself for what happened to her. The fault was all hers, none of his.

There was so much she was learning about Adán in the cab of a royal billionaire’s truck.
